Ordinals
beta
Sat 799140508327054
decimal
159828.508327054
degree
0°159828′564″508327054‴
percentile
38.05430996219567%
name
ieoikaqewtf
cycle
0
epoch
0
period
79
block
159828
offset
508327054
timestamp
2011-12-30 15:36:46 UTC
rarity
common
prev
next